Frequently Asked Questions about hotels in Montenegro

  • What are the best landmarks to visit in Montenegro?

    Montenegro boasts stunning landmarks! For breathtaking views, Kotor Bay is a must-see, with its charming towns like Perast and Kotor itself, featuring the impressive St. Tryphon Cathedral. Up north, you'll find Ostrog Monastery, perched dramatically on a cliffside, a significant pilgrimage site. Cetinje, the former royal capital, offers historical sites like Cetinje Monastery and Biljarda Palace. Lake Skadar, the largest lake in the Balkans, provides stunning scenery and opportunities for birdwatching.

  • What are some must-do activities in Montenegro?

    Montenegro offers diverse activities. Explore the Bay of Kotor by boat, hike the scenic trails of Durmitor National Park, or relax on the beaches of Budva Riviera. Consider white-water rafting on the Tara River, a truly adventurous experience. For a cultural immersion, visit the old towns of Kotor, Budva, and Bar, each with unique architecture and history. Don't miss the opportunity to sample local wines in the wine regions of the country.

  • When is the ideal time to visit Montenegro?

    The best time to visit is during the shoulder seasons, spring (April-May) and fall (September-October), for pleasant weather and fewer crowds. Summers (June-August) are hot and busy, while winters (November-March) can be cold, especially in the mountainous regions, though ideal for skiing in the north.

  • Is renting a car recommended for exploring Montenegro?

    Renting a car is highly recommended, especially if you plan to explore beyond the coastal areas. Public transportation is available, but limited, and a car provides more flexibility to reach remote areas and hidden gems. However, be aware that some mountain roads can be challenging.

  • Are credit cards widely accepted in Montenegro?

    Credit cards are increasingly accepted in larger cities and tourist areas, but it's always advisable to have some cash on hand, especially in smaller towns and villages. Smaller establishments may prefer cash transactions.
  • What are the largest airports in Montenegro?

    The main international airport is Podgorica Airport (TGD), serving most international flights. Tivat Airport (TIV) is another important airport, mainly serving charter flights and located closer to the Bay of Kotor.
  • Are there any unwritten rules of behavior visitors should know about Montenegro?

    Montenegrins are generally welcoming and hospitable. It's considered polite to greet people with a handshake or a nod. When visiting monasteries or religious sites, dress modestly. Learning a few basic phrases in Montenegrin is always appreciated.
  • What local specialties should you try in Montenegro?

    You must try Njeguški pršut (smoked ham), a local delicacy. Other specialties include Kačamak (a cornmeal and potato dish), and fresh seafood, particularly along the coast. Don't forget to sample the local wines, especially Vranac (red) and Krstač (white).
  • Where are the best shopping spots in Montenegro?

    Kotor, Budva, and Podgorica offer a variety of shopping options, from local crafts and souvenirs to international brands. The old towns often have charming boutiques and shops selling traditional goods. Larger shopping malls are located in the main cities.

  • What are the most common travel mistakes tourists make in Montenegro?

    One common mistake is underestimating travel times between locations, especially in mountainous areas. Another is not having enough cash on hand, particularly in smaller towns. Failing to book accommodations in advance, especially during peak season, can also be problematic.
